Pokemon Masters Announced For iOS, Android

A brand new Pokemon game called Pokemon Masters is currently in development, and it will be released soon on iOS and Android worldwide.

The new game is being developed by The Pokemon Company in collaboration with DeNa and it will be called Pokemon Masters. Work seems to be almost done, as The Pokemon Company announced that Pokemon Masters will be released this Summer worldwide.

Pokemon Masters is being designed to be an easy to pick-up and play title. All battles will involve three different trainers complete with their own Pokemon.

As of now, 65 pairs have been confirmed, and many of the series’ iconic monsters will make an appearance, such as Lucario, Pikachu, and many others. It’s also been confirmed that more trainers will be made available after the game releases.

With a big emphasis on battles and RPG elements, Pokemon Masters is going to be the Pokemon games players will want to play if they have grown tired on Pokemon GO.

Pokemon Masters launches this Summer on iOS and Android as a free to start game.
